Vacatures
>
Amsterdam

    Java Developer - Amsterdam, Nederland - Picnic

    Picnic
    Picnic background
    CDI
    Beschrijving

    Check out to learn about our open-source Error Prone Support project

    At Picnic, we're revolutionizing the way people buy groceries with our innovative and sustainable app-only service. We do almost everything in-house, developing cutting-edge technologies and processes to ensure we continue to grow rapidly without missing a beat. If you're a passionate Java developer we're offering you the opportunity to join the diverse team at our Amsterdam HQ and make a real difference in our scaleup environment.

    In a nutshell

    Picnic has over 20 Java backend development teams, each highly involved with and essential to all parts of the company. From enabling a smooth shopping experience, to ensuring we fulfill our customers' orders efficiently in our warehouses: there's a wide range of products to work on. Product teams are also supported by the work of our platform teams on key technologies and infrastructure. Finding the right team to join is a breeze through a 'Tech Safari' that will be organized after your onboarding. You'll get to join three different teams for a week, to find the best match.

    At Picnic your skills will be complemented with the latest tech and our diverse projects will keep you challenged and motivated. From designing, developing, and testing new user-facing features, to optimizing supply chain systems and improving the scalability and security of our platform: you'll be managing individual project priorities, deadlines, and deliverables, while finding yourself fully immersed in an engaging startup culture.

    What you'll do

    • Take ownership of projects, grow, and work collaboratively with your colleagues
    • Design, test, evolve, and evaluate the nuts and bolts of our operation while offering a creative and analytical approach
    • You feel at home writing platforms and display an intricate understanding of how each line of code fits into a business plan

    We don't hide what we do. Instead, we open-source with the community that helped us grow. Here's proof:

    Technologies we use

    • Java 21 (Spring 6 with Spring Boot 3, Reactor, Immutables, Maven)
    • Python 3.x
    • RabbitMQ and Kafka
    • PostgreSQL, MongoDB
    • Git and Docker
    • AWS, Helm, Terraform, Kubernetes, Vault and Datadog

    Hungry for more? Check out for an overview of our tech stack.

    About you

    • You have a Bachelor's or Master's Degree in Computer Science, Artificial Intelligence, Information Technology, Computer Engineering or a related technical field
    • You have at least two years of professional experience in programming and software development
    • You have a profound understanding of back-end development, including Java, Spring MVC, MongoDB and PostgreSQL
    • Your English skills are on point (no Dutch required)

    Picnic PerksEvery expert was once a beginner

    • You'll get plenty of opportunities to challenge yourself and grow, including the Picnic Tech Academy, Lunch & Learn sessions, and tailored soft skills training. We also offer free professional weekly language courses.

    Make a difference

    • You'll work in an awesome startup environment with the freedom to drive your own projects and create a visible impact.
    • Our fully electric vehicles and sustainable business model mean you'll also be contributing to making the world a better place

    Teamwork makes the dream work

    • With more than 80 nationalities across 3 countries, you'll be part of a diverse company with plenty of cool stuff to get involved with, from board game evenings to after-work drinks to our company ski trip and more

    You are what you eat

    • You'll get freshly prepared, healthy lunches and snacks (with plenty of vegetarian, vegan, and halal options). Coffee snob? Don't worry, our amazing Picnic barista has you covered.

    Stay healthy

    • Mental health is important. As well as having the option to speak with Picnic colleagues who act as confidential advisors, our collaboration with OpenUp gives you easy access to professional psychologists, along with workshops and materials.
    • There are plenty of sports communities and events to get involved with, from tennis to yoga, to climbing

    Attractive package

    • We offer competitive compensation and a pension plan that looks out for your future self, as well as 25 vacation days per year, so you can recharge your batteries

    Benefits for expats

    It can be daunting starting a new job AND moving to a new country. That's why we offer lots of support for our many expat colleagues, including:

    • Relocation package: If you join Picnic from abroad, we'll cover your trip to Amsterdam, sponsor your Visa, and offer you a month of accommodation while you settle in (as long as regulations allow).
    • In the Netherlands, we offer support with your first tax report as well as arranging the 30% ruling.
    • From health insurance to living arrangements to pet passports, there are always colleagues who've faced the same challenges and are more than happy to help

    Commitment to equal opportunities

    Picnic is an equal opportunity employer—this means that all decisions regarding applications will be based on qualifications and merit. Applicants will be regarded independently of age, gender identity or expression, sexual orientation, ethnicity, skin color, civil status, religious beliefs, physical or mental disability, or any other factors protected by law.

    At Picnic, we celebrate and value our differences and are committed to building a safe and inclusive working environment where everyone can be themselves.

    With a data-driven approach, an app-only store and a fleet of electric vehicles, Picnic has become Europe's fastest growing online supermarket.


  • Espabila

    Java Developer

    6 dagen geleden


    Espabila Amsterdam, Nederland Voltijd

    Ben jij een Java developer die op zoek is naar een grote diversiteit aan projecten waar je zelf inspraak in hebt? Niet willen werken met legacy problemen, maar werken aan mooie greenfield projecten met de nieuwste tools. · CONSULTANCY DIE HET NET EVEN ANDERS DOET · Omdat wij niet ...

  • Energie Data Services Nederland

    Senior Java Developer

    2 weken geleden


    Energie Data Services Nederland Nederland

    Energiemarkt | 32-40 uur | Amersfoort / Hybride | v/m/x | IT | 46-85k / jaarincl. 8% vakantiegeld + leaseauto of mobiliteitsbudget · Wil jij werkenaan innovatieve softwaredie de energietransitievooruitbrengt? · Bij EDSN draag jij bij aan de verduurzaming van Nederland. Elke dag. ...

  • Stripe Payments Europe, Limited

    Senior Java Developer

    4 dagen geleden


    Stripe Payments Europe, Limited Nederland

    Senior Java Developer · First8 Conclusion is op zoek naar een Java engineer Ons budget is EUR per jaar · Onze technologieën: · Java, Docker, Kubernetes, Java EE, Spring · Wat vragen wij van jou: · Voor deze functie heb je minimaal hbo-diploma in de richting van informatica. ...

  • Java Professionals

    Java Developer Security

    1 week geleden


    Java Professionals Netherlands, Nederland Voltijd

    _Wil jij als Java Developer werken voor een groot, innovatief en internationaal bedrijf met de focus op security? Hier krijg je de kans om in een hybride werkomgeving bij te dragen aan projecten met impact op miljoenen klanten_ *Wat ga je doen?* Binnen deze functie richt je als J ...

  • Vereniging Informatiewetenschappen Amsterdam

    Junior java developer

    4 dagen geleden


    Vereniging Informatiewetenschappen Amsterdam Amsterdam, Nederland

    Junior java developer · This job is only for people who speak dutch · Complexe applicaties realiseren en applicatiecomponenten bouwen en testen. Dat doe je vanuit Apeldoorn als junior Java-developer, terwijl de Belastingdienst je volop helpt in je ontwikkeling. Al lerend draag j ...

  • Stripe Payments Europe, Limited

    Senior Java developer

    1 week geleden


    Stripe Payments Europe, Limited Nederland

    Senior Java developer - Amersfoort · Nederlandse Spoorwegen is op zoek naar een Java engineer Ons budget is EUR per jaar · Onze technologieën: · ActiveMQ, Architect, Azure, DevOps, Docker, ELK, H2, Java, Java EE, Kubernetes, Oracle, PostgreSQL, Product Owner, REST, Spring, Spr ...

  • CodeGuild

    Senior Java Developer

    4 dagen geleden


    CodeGuild Amsterdam, Nederland

    Jouw baan: Senior Java Developer Amsterdam · Wil jij deze succesvolle GreenTech scaleup helpen in hun missie deze wereld een betere plek te maken? · Lijkt jou het een toffe uitdaging om een nieuwe Dev Hub op te zetten waar je enorm veel impact kunt hebben? · Houd je van ...

  • StarApple

    Senior Java Developer

    1 week geleden


    StarApple Amsterdam, Nederland

    Dit bedrijf is een innovatieve en snelgroeiende organisatie. Ze zijn momenteel marktleider in de beneluxe en werken samen met een aantal bekende klanten uit verschillende branches, waaronder overheid, finance , zakelijke dienstverlening en zorg. Er valt dus altijd iets te leren v ...

  • Kabisa

    Senior Java Developer

    1 week geleden


    Kabisa Nederland

    Als Senior Java Developer van ons Scrum-team lever je iteratief maatwerksoftware op en ben je betrokken bij softwarearchitectuur beslissingen. Kwaliteit en vakmanschap zijn kernwaarden bij ons. We zoeken iemand die het voortouw neemt en actief bijdraagt aan de groei van collega's ...

  • Sportlink Services

    Java/react Developer

    3 dagen geleden


    Sportlink Services Amsterdam, Nederland

    Wil jij werken bij een organisatie die maatschappelijke impact maakt op sportend Nederland? Ben jij een ervaren developer die samen met het Sportlink team de software en producten naar een hoger niveau wilt tillen? · Functieomschrijving · De verantwoordelijkheid is groot, gelukki ...

  • Stripe Payments Europe, Limited

    Fullstack Java developer

    1 week geleden


    Stripe Payments Europe, Limited Nederland

    Fullstack Java developer - Amersfoort · NS is op zoek naar een Java engineer Ons budget is EUR per jaar · ???? Onze technologieën: · Architect, Azure, DevOps, Docker, ELK, Fullstack, H2, Java, Java EE, Kubernetes, Oracle, PostgreSQL, Product Owner, REST, Spring, Spring Boot, V ...

  • Atos

    Java Developer

    1 week geleden


    Atos Amstelveen, Nederland

    Eviden is een bedrijf van de Atos Group met een jaaromzet van c. € 5 miljard en is wereldwijd een leider in datagedreven, betrouwbare en duurzame digitale transformatie. Als een digitaal bedrijf van de volgende generatie met toonaangevende posities op het gebied van digitaal, clo ...

  • Atos

    Java Developer

    2 dagen geleden


    Atos Amstelveen, Nederland

    Eviden is een bedrijf van de Atos Group met een jaaromzet van c. € 5 miljard en is wereldwijd een leider in datagedreven, betrouwbare en duurzame digitale transformatie. Als een digitaal bedrijf van de volgende generatie met toonaangevende posities op het gebied van digitaal, clo ...

  • DPA Professionals

    Java/Kotlin Developer

    3 dagen geleden


    DPA Professionals Amsterdam, Nederland

    Wat je gaat doen: · Of beter nog, wat wil jij doen? Binnen DPA GEOS, onderdeel van Team Eiffel, zijn wij op zoek naar enthousiaste Kotlin/Java developers om ons development team te versterken. Als developer werk je in Agile/Scrum teams bij onze klanten en daarbij kun je eventuee ...

  • Atos

    Java Developer

    1 week geleden


    Atos Amstelveen, Nederland

    Eviden is een bedrijf van de Atos Group met een jaaromzet van c. € 5 miljard en is wereldwijd een leider in datagedreven, betrouwbare en duurzame digitale transformatie. Als een digitaal bedrijf van de volgende generatie met toonaangevende posities op het gebied van digitaal, clo ...

  • Searchsoftware

    Senior Java Developer

    1 week geleden


    Searchsoftware Amsterdam, Nederland Voltijd

    Betrokkenheid is de sleutel tot succes als het gaat om dienstverlening. Op deze plek hebben ze dat goed begrepen. Ze houden zich hier bezig met verzekeringen en zorgen ervoor dat meer dan 5 miljoen trouwe klanten altijd en overal kunnen rekenen op hun diensten. · Vertel verder.. ...

  • Picnic

    Java Developer

    1 week geleden


    Picnic Amsterdam, Nederland CDI

    Check out to learn about why we chose Java · At Picnic, we're revolutionizing the way people buy groceries with our innovative and sustainable app-only service. We do almost everything in-house, developing cutting-edge technologies and processes to ensure we continue to grow rapi ...

  • Atos

    Java Developer

    6 dagen geleden


    Atos Amstelveen, Nederland

    Eviden is een bedrijf van de Atos Group met een jaaromzet van c. € 5 miljard en is wereldwijd een leider in datagedreven, betrouwbare en duurzame digitale transformatie. Als een digitaal bedrijf van de volgende generatie met toonaangevende posities op het gebied van digitaal, clo ...

  • Next-Link

    Java developer

    6 dagen geleden


    Next-Link Amsterdam, Nederland

    Job Description · Java Developer · Key Responsibilities: · Write modern, modular, scalable, and reusable code using Java and Spring Boot. · Understand and apply concepts like dependency injection, microservices, REST, HTTP, CI/CD, and Git. · Develop and maintain applications usin ...

  • Eagle Eye Networks

    Java Developer

    4 dagen geleden


    Eagle Eye Networks Amsterdam, Nederland Voltijd

    Summary · As Software Engineer (Java) you will be working on a daily basis expanding our video surveillance cloud Eagle Eye Camera Manager. From innovative new features for end-users to scaling our multi-cluster, high availability cloud to support the fast-growing amount of conn ...